The Operations Center Director has 7 main focuses :
Manages and supervises all UNOPS Operations at the OC level;
Ensures the self sustainability of the Operations Center;
Effective institutional and organizational cooperation resulting in well-coordinated results and which contributes to a stronger UN presence;
Increases the profile, partnerships and business in developing a vision and strategic plan to position UNOPS as a viable and attractive service provider of choice in the region or country;
Increases the effectiveness and quality of delivery of the OC portfolio in guiding Project Managers;
Ensures the timely completion of quality projects within budget limits and with full cost recovery
Provides support to the Regional Director and the Executive Office with regard to the regional and global enhancement of UNOPS as a respected service provider
In particular, the OC Director:
Assesses the requirements of the host Government and other UNOPS clients such as bilateral and multilateral donors, IFI’s and the UN system, in order to identify and pursue opportunities to deliver UNOPS’ services.
Oversees, manages and controls the project portfolio of the Operation Center (OC), ensuring overall accountability with strict respect of all rules and regulations of UNOPS.
Acts as UNOPS coordination point with the UNCT, the Representatives of UN Agencies, donor agencies, and other international cooperation entities to ensure adequate coordination of the activities of UNOPS in the country, discusses problems and seeks solutions to issues that may arise;
Leads a team of programme managers and specialists which aligns organizational capacities to meet specific needs of the client community within the broader mandate of UNOPS; maintains appropriate arrangements and capacity for direct transactional support for delivery of the Operations Centre portfolio. Finds creative solutions to ensure smooth and effective project delivery.
Controls a Delegation of $250,000 to oversee and approve contracts, and waivers, and ensure proper submissions to the relevant UNOPS contracts committee above that limit;
Put in place a proper internal control framework according to UNOPS rules and develop internal performance tracking and reporting tools from both a financial and project delivery management perspective;
Assesses the requirements of Governments and other UNOPS direct/indirect clients and in conjunction with them, identifies and develops opportunities for UNOPS to provide services;
Develops a strong analytical vision with regard to the overall business and development environment.
Oversees formulation of proposals, project documents and agreements in connection with identified opportunities and in cooperation with the clients;
Builds up the capacity of the Operation Center in accordance with UNOPS’ standards and in proportion to the business acquired and implemented;
Communicates activities with UN system partners, UNOPS Regional and Headquarters offices, other clients, media and with the Governments and keeps them informed of UNOPS activities;
Provides financial and administrative reports to the Regional Director in the areas of business delivery and development; Monitors and controls programme/project implementation, reviews progress, identifies constraints and takes corrective action ensuring proper early warning and risk alerts to the Regional Office;
Coordinates activities with other UN Agencies and clusters on behalf of UNOPS on Inter-Agency matters, and ensures timely distribution of information to all relevant UNOPS staff;
Maintains regular contacts and liaise with the appropriate level at Government entities to provide programme information and clarification in order to ensure appropriate application of privileges and immunities as they apply in the country.
Reviews and develops the management team at the OC level and ensure proper distribution of activities;
Represents UNOPS in the framework of the UN Country Team and Security Management Team.
Ensure that the main values of the organization: independence, loyalty, accountability, respect for human rights, impartiality and integrity, are adhered to by all UNOPS personnel and at all times.
Represents UNOPS in the UN Country Team (UNCT), and supports the UNCT programming and advocacy activities; Participates actively and effectively in UNCT meetings, and contributes to the formulation and implementation of United Nations Development Assistance Framework/One Programme, Integrated Strategic Framework, and Delivering as One within the country; Is accountable to the Resident Coordinator for actions as part of the UNCT, makes substantial contribution to UNCT’s work, and assumes a leadership role as relates to UNOPS’ mandate; Participates in UNCT initiatives to strengthen UN coherence, inclusiveness, and aid effectiveness, including playing an active role in the Operations Management Teams (OMTs) and other senior management group of the country team; Keeps UN Resident Coordinator abreast of UNOPS activities within the country through regular communication, including a formal regular reporting on business acquisition and implementation of activities led by UNOPS as part of the UNDAF .
